Woman loses nearly $10K after giving envelope of money to Uber driver in Lebanon...

LEBANON COUNTY, Pa. (WHP) — State police are investigating after a woman lost almost $10,000 in a fraudulent Uber transaction. Troopers said the 53-year-old Fredericksburg woman was contacted by the Lebanon County Federal Credit Union to warn her about fraudulent charges to her account in the total of $9,500.

Vaping dangers for teens: What parents should know | Health Smart

YORK, Pa. — There are plenty of warnings out there about the dangers of vaping, and one expert with UPMC says teens are most at risk. "There's no definite evidence that vaping is safer than cigarette smoke. It can cause acute damage to the lung," said Dr. Santosh Nepal, a pulmonologist at UPMC.

Smoothie King to open in Cumberland County

A national smoothie chain that helped bring smoothies to mainstream America in the 1970s is arriving in the Harrisburg region. Smoothie King is slated to open at 3224 Market St. in Camp Hill, joining McAlister’s Deli on a property where a Rite Aid drug store had operated, according to Landmark Commercial Realty in East

PennDOT considering new roundabout in York County

WEIGELSTOWN, Pa. (WHTM) — A York County intersection could become the Midstate’s newest roundabout and PennDOT has an open house set to discuss the plans.
